South African Deep Sea Trawling Industry Association (SADSTIA)

AssociationFinder

The SA Deep Sea Trawling Industry Association (SADSTIA) is an association of South African trawler owners and operators. It is a recognised industrial body that interacts with government, non-governmental organisations and other interested parties for the benefit of the South African deep-sea trawling industry.

South African Deaf Sports Federation (SADSF)

AssociationFinder

South African Deaf Sports Federation (SADSF) is the official governing body of Deaf Sports in South Africa responsible for sending, supporting, funding the teams representing South Africa and the Deaf sports people at the Deaflympics since 1993.

The SADSF is also affiliated with South African Sports Confederation and Olympic Committee (SASCOC) as known newly named Sports South Africa (Sports SA), which is the national governing body in South Africa responsible for Olympics and Paralympics.

South Coast Rock Lobster Industry Association (SCRLIA)

AssociationFinder

The South African Rock Lobster Industry Association (SCRLIA) is an industrial body as recognized in terms of Section 8 of the Marine Living Resources Act, which represents rights holders in the South Coast Rock Lobster sector of the South African fishing industry. The association interacts with government, NGOs and other interested parties for the benefit of the industry.

Southern Africa Institute for Artisans (SAIFA)

AssociationFinder

SAIFA, the Southern African Institute For Artisans, is a non-profit organization committed to the holistic development of artisans and local communities. Established with a mission to enhance the skills, employability, and socio-economic well-being of artisans, SAIFA focuses on facilitation, training, mentoring, and placement within the artisanal sector. The organization extends its impact by actively participating in the implementation of large-scale community-based employment creation initiatives, including the Expanded Public Works Programme (EPWP) and Community Work Programme (CWP).
